Look 1: The striped Breton Tee – Is there anything more French?

Is there anything more Parisian than a navy striped cotton Tee? I wear my long-sleeved striped tee from KULE all year, but in the summer, I love it with white jeans. Mine is a little thick, like Saint James tees. The thickness makes it perfect to wear over a t-shirt or tied at the waist.

On a light pink background are four different brands of long-sleeved striped tees.

Wear a long tee like this or an oversized one like the boyfriend tee. Both will be staples in your wardrobe to wear with white denim, under blazers, a leather jacket, or just about anything else you can think of wearing!

I love mixing my stripes with Artemis loafers. They are one-of-a-kind footwear, handmade in Istanbul by a small family-owned shop. These beautiful shoes are made from Kilim carpets. I chose the Artemis Smoking Shoe as it is menswear-inspired and has a higher profile. I love how they look with white denim!

Look 4: White Jeans With a Camel Blazer & Brown Shoes/Bag

White and brown or camel might be my favorite look of all. The Topshop white jeans have brown or camel-colored stitching. It’s subtle, but I do love the little detail when wearing a camel blazer or this brown corduroy shirt.

Look 5: Oversize Shirt or Sweater in off-White

This oversized shirt from Frank & Eileen was a bit of a splurge purchase. It’s a shirt, and it’s also a light jacket. The oversize allows layering just about anything under it. It comes in only two sizes, which emphasizes the oversized, unstructured fit. The possibilities with this piece are endless.

I love the look of white with cream or ecru, and this shirt and my Topshop white jeans are the perfect combination for the beach!
